He won a state championship with\u00a0<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">St. Thomas Aquinas in 2014. Ray earned All-State Class 7A first-team honors as a senior along with first team All-Country. He finished with 7.5 sacks, two forced fumbles and 70 tackles with 20 for loss. Ray was a reserve freshman but earned playing time sophomore year and finished with 27 tackles, seven tackles for loss, and 4.5 sacks. <\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">He started four games in the absence of <a href=\"https:\/\/lwosonnfl.ms.lastwordonsports.com\/2018\/03\/28\/harold-landry-2018-draft-profile\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><strong>Harold Landry<\/strong><\/a> as a junior and had 39 tackles, four tackles for loss and 2.5 sacks. Ray had his first interception against Louisville which led to their first lead of the game in a comeback win. With Harold Landry departing to the NFL Draft, 2018 was Ray\u2019s time to shine. It didn\u2019t take long for Ray to show off his talent which had been buried on the depth chart. In the third game of the season vs Wake Forest, he tallied four sacks and eight total tackles and broke the BC single-game sack record. Ray finished his senior season with nine sacks and 11.5 tackles for loss with 44 total tackles.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">In a draft class loaded with talent along the defensive line, Ray struggles to gain notice. He also shared a defensive line with <a href=\"https:\/\/lwosonnfl.ms.lastwordonsports.com\/2019\/03\/21\/zach-allen-2019-nfl-draft-profile\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><strong>Zach Allen<\/strong><\/a> who is garnering a lot of hype in the draft community. Despite being a mostly unknown player, he has traits that could translate well to the NFL. He showed a lot of improvement at BC and he could be an impactful edge rusher in the NFL. To make an impact rushing the passer he needs to employ a pass rush plan more consistently and learn how to point his hips and toes when bending on the edge. Ray is already a good run defender and a sure tackler which means he could make an impact on special teams early on. He could be a good late-round selection who could contribute on special teams early on and develop his pass rushing with adequate coaching.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><a id=\"WdJZ7nB0TVhzEj2p45MVhQ\" class=\"gie-single\" href=\"http:\/\/www.gettyimages.com\/detail\/617810902\" target=\"_blank\" style=\"color:#a7a7a7;text-decoration:none;font-weight:normal !important;border:none;display:inline-block;\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Embed from Getty Images<\/a><script>window.gie=window.gie||function(c){(gie.q=gie.q||[]).push(c)};gie(function(){gie.widgets.load({id:'WdJZ7nB0TVhzEj2p45MVhQ',sig:'2jQzrbfQXuyS7UJoAdmH8KQgMbEagZypIQ2l8aiJ3WI=',w:'594px',h:'396px',items:'617810902',caption: true ,tld:'com',is360: false })});<\/script><script src='\/\/embed-cdn.gettyimages.com\/widgets.js' charset='utf-8' async><\/script><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Overview Position: Edge defender Height: 6&#8217;3&#8243; Weight: 257 pounds School: Boston College Eagles Combine Performance Data 40-yard dash: 4.83 seconds Bench press:\u00a025 reps (tied for third-best among edge rushers) Vertical jump: 34 inches Broad jump: 9 feet, 10 inches Three-cone drill: 7.34 seconds\u00a0 Wyatt Ray 2019 NFL Draft Profile Wyatt Ray appeared in all 12 [&hellip;]<\/p>\n","protected":false},"author":2913,"featured_media":64113,"comment_status":"open","ping_status":"open","sticky":false,"template":"","format":"standard","meta":{"_lmt_disableupdate":"","_lmt_disable":"","sfio_featured_image":false,"sfio_embed_code":"","_ef_editorial_meta_date_first-draft-date":"","_ef_editorial_meta_paragraph_assignment":"","_ef_editorial_meta_checkbox_needs-photo":"1","_ef_editorial_meta_number_word-count":"","footnotes":""},"categories":[1647],"tags":[4070],"class_list":["post-63814","post","type-post","status-publish","format-standard","has-post-thumbnail","hentry","category-nfl-draft","tag-2019-nfl-draft"],"modified_by":"David Latham, Managing Editor","_links":{"self":[{"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ts\/63814","targetHints":{"allow":["GET"]}}],"collection":[{"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ts"}],"about":[{"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/types\/post"}],"author":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/users\/2913"}],"replies":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/comments?post=63814"}],"version-history":[{"count":0,"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ts\/63814\/revisions"}],"wp:featuredmedia":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/media\/64113"}],"wp:attachment":[{"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/media?parent=63814"}],"wp:term":[{"taxonomy":"category","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/categories?post=63814"},{"taxonomy":"post_tag","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/tags?post=63814"}],"curies":[{"name":"wp","href":"https:\/\/api.w.org\/{rel}","templated":true}]}}
